**Vendor note: Inkmill markdown pipeline**

Rendering for Parchway docs is outsourced to Inkmill under an annual contract, renewing each March. They handle sanitization and PDF export; we own the upload queue. SLA: 4-hour response on rendering failures. Escalate only after two failed retries. Their support desk is reachable at the address below.

billing contact of hahaf-baguf = zorael.tammir.jorius@sivrelhq.internal

**Alert: TileCache hit ratio below 70%**

Fires when the Mossbank tile-rendering cache layer degrades for 10+ minutes. Usual causes: eviction storm after a style deploy, or the warmer job stalled. Impact: render latency spikes on map zoom levels 12–16. First move: check warmer job status and recent style pushes. Do not flush the cache blindly — cold starts take an hour. Full diagnosis tree is on the internal page here:

operations page: https://confluence.qorvellabs.internal/pages/projects/projects/projects

All release builds of Linklattice, the deep-link routing library maintained by the Kestrel Mobile team at Ovenbird Software, are signed before publication to the internal artifact mirror. Client apps refuse unsigned routing tables, so skipping this step breaks navigation across every integrated app. Signing happens in the sealed build stage; manual signing is only permitted during a declared incident. Verification is performed against the public signing key below.

release key, tajep-tahaf: bky19_d9NV5NtNvNNQVVKBK4P

# Template rendering performance (Quillmark service)
# New folks: rendered fragments are cached aggressively because the
# Harbordeck layouts are expensive to compose. Cache keys include the
# template version, so bumping versions invalidates cleanly. Misses
# fall through to the fragment store, which also backs warm-up jobs
# at deploy time. That store is reached via the connection string
# directly below this comment.

primary connection of yagep-kahip = redis://giliel_svc:zYiKsLL2PLpfPL@db-348f.xolmarsys.corp:5432/fenwyn